What is a unit process controller?

Unit Process Controllers are professionals responsible for monitoring, controlling, and optimizing specific stages or units within a manufacturing or industrial production process. They ensure that equipment and operations run efficiently, safely, and according to quality standards. Their tasks typically include adjusting system parameters, troubleshooting issues, and recording data to maintain product consistency and compliance with regulations. Unit Process Controllers often work in industries such as chemical manufacturing, water treatment, and food processing.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a unit process controller?

To thrive as a Unit Process Controller, you generally need a solid understanding of chemical or industrial processes, basic engineering principles, and a relevant technical diploma or degree. Familiarity with process control systems such as DCS (Distributed Control Systems), PLCs (Programmable Logic Controllers), and safety protocols is typically required. Attention to detail, critical thinking, and effective communication are vital soft skills for monitoring operations and troubleshooting issues. These competencies ensure efficient, safe, and consistent production, minimizing downtime and maintaining quality standards.

What are some common challenges faced by unit process controllers and how can they be addressed?

Unit Process Controllers often face challenges such as responding quickly to unexpected process deviations, maintaining equipment efficiency, and ensuring strict adherence to safety protocols. They must monitor multiple systems simultaneously and troubleshoot issues under time pressure, which requires strong attention to detail and clear communication with maintenance and engineering teams. Staying up-to-date with process control technologies and participating in regular training can help controllers effectively manage these challenges and contribute to smooth plant operations.

Seeking a detail oriented Unit Controller 3 with strong financial analysis skills to manage the financials and accounting for a multi-outlet client account- a well known concert location in Hollywood. Total managed annual food & beverage revenues are approximately $14 million. The location offers exceptional food services that range from fine dining in our premium restaurants to grab and go at our concessions. Providing an unforgettable guest experience is our focus.
The Unit Controller 3 is responsible for the accounting, financial analysis and corporate revenue reporting functions for this location. This position executes the accounts receivable process from contracting thru collections, enters weekly accounts payables, POS reporting, produces weekly financial reconciliation, investigates and corrects variances as needed and provides the operations team with ad hoc financial analysis to aid in managing the business. The controller works closely with the General Manager to analyze month-end reporting, provide variance explanations and corrective action plans as needed, annual budgeting and monthly re-forecasting.
This position requires excellent organizational skills, a high degree of integrity and accountability along with a strong desire for transparency. Excellent communication, interpersonal and team-building skills are also required. The ideal candidate will have a financial background with contract management, preferably food services, in a progressive and fast paced environment. This is a Hands-On in Unit Controller role.
